Welcome to Reviews Inside TV! Today, we’re going to take a closer look at the TECBOT M1 PRO Robotic Vacuum Cleaner and Mop. It’s packed with features, so let’s find out if this robot is as smart as it sounds.

The TECBOT M1 PRO is an all-in-one cleaning solution that combines both vacuuming and mopping functions into one sleek robot. It’s designed to make home cleaning easier, especially for busy households or those who want a hassle-free way to keep their floors clean. With features like Laser LiDAR navigation, a modular design, and a 150-minute runtime, it promises to cover large areas and clean efficiently. Plus, with a 5200mAh battery, it claims to handle up to 200 square meters without breaking a sweat. But how does it actually perform in the real world? Let’s break it down.

First, let’s talk about the specifications. The TECBOT M1 PRO uses an LDS laser navigation system, which is known for its precise mapping and obstacle avoidance. This feature allows it to intelligently plan its cleaning path and avoid obstacles, ensuring it can cover your entire home without bumping into things. It also has a three-layer filter that is washable, a key feature for those who suffer from allergies or have pets. The mop’s automatic lifting system is another standout, preventing the mop from wetting your carpet while it crosses over. And for those of us who don’t want to worry about recharging every other hour, the 5200mAh battery promises up to 150 minutes of cleaning time.

In terms of setup and usage, the TECBOT M1 PRO is user-friendly. You just need to install the app, connect it to Wi-Fi, and let the robot do its thing. The mapping and cleaning paths are visible in real-time on the app, so you can see exactly where it’s been and where it’s headed. The mop and dust tanks are easy to remove and clean, and the robot’s ability to lift the mop when encountering carpets is smooth, ensuring no accidental wet spots on your rugs. I’ve tested it on both hard floors and carpets, and it handles both well. On hard floors, the cleaning was thorough, leaving no streaks behind, while on carpets, it navigated effortlessly without getting stuck.

Now, let’s discuss the pros and cons. On the plus side, the TECBOT M1 PRO offers excellent navigation, thanks to its laser-guided system. It avoids obstacles and falls with ease, and its ability to map your home in real-time adds to its overall efficiency. The automatic mop lifting system is a game-changer, especially for homes with a mix of carpets and hard floors. The large battery capacity is another advantage, giving it long cleaning cycles, which is great if you have a larger home. The modular design makes it easy to maintain, and the noise level, at 68dB, is relatively quiet compared to other models I’ve tested.

But, like any product, there are a few drawbacks. While the robot has a solid set of features, it doesn’t come with a cleaning base station like some competing models, meaning you’ll have to manually clean the mop after each session. This can be a hassle if you’re not in the mood to do it every time. Another downside is the lack of advanced mapping options like zone cleaning or virtual walls, which could have been useful for those with specific cleaning preferences. Some users may also find the app interface a little basic, as it doesn’t offer advanced customization or cleaning patterns compared to other high-end robotic vacuums.

When it comes to value for money, the TECBOT M1 PRO does offer good value considering the features it packs. It’s reasonably priced for a robot that offers both vacuuming and mopping in one. If you compare it to other robots in a similar price range, such as the Xiaomi Mi or the Ecovacs Deebot, it holds up well, especially with its long battery life and powerful suction. However, it’s important to note that the lack of a base station may be a dealbreaker for some, especially if you’re used to that convenience.

Comparing the TECBOT M1 PRO to other similar products, one of the closest competitors would be the Roborock S5. While both offer mopping and vacuuming capabilities, the Roborock S5 includes more advanced features like app-controlled zone cleaning and a more refined map-building system. However, the TECBOT M1 PRO makes up for these differences with its automatic mop-lifting feature, which is a huge benefit for mixed flooring environments.

The build quality of the TECBOT M1 PRO is solid. The materials feel premium, and the design is streamlined, which helps with its low noise operation. The noise level, especially at 68dB, is quieter than many of the competing models, making it a good choice for people who value a quieter clean. While there is no long-term data available for this specific model, TECBOT has a solid reputation for building durable products, and the modular design hints at easy repairs or part replacements, should anything go wrong.

As for customer support, TECBOT has a good reputation for responsiveness, though I didn’t personally need to reach out to them for this review. Their customer service is accessible via their website, and reviews generally highlight their helpfulness in addressing issues related to the product.

If there’s one thing that stands out about this product, it’s the way it combines both vacuuming and mopping in a seamless package. The ability to lift the mop automatically when encountering carpets is a unique feature that is often overlooked by other robots in this price range. However, the lack of a base station does require some manual effort when it comes to cleaning the mop, which could be a minor inconvenience for some users.

In conclusion, the TECBOT M1 PRO is a solid robotic vacuum and mop combo that excels at navigation, battery life, and keeping your carpets dry while mopping. It might not have all the bells and whistles of some higher-end models, but it offers excellent value for the price. If you’re looking for a reliable, low-maintenance robot vacuum that doesn’t break the bank, this could be the one for you.
